What the weeks look like
Two people read
everything you build.
- A mentor from Relativity reviews your work, and so does someone else in your cohort. Both reviews are part of the task, not a favour you have to chase.
- Live sessions every week, hosted by the people who mentor you. Recorded, so a bad week is not a lost one.
- Two rooms from day one: your cohort, and a help room where mentors answer.

Who runs this
Relativity
Running since 2020, relaunched as Relevate in 2025.
Where they are
- Chicago (HQ)
- Kraków
- London
- Sydney
Headquarters at 231 S. LaSalle, Chicago - 100,000 sq ft.
